G.I. Joe, A Real American Hero #138
Grade: Raw New, Sealed
Publisher: Marvel Release Date: 1993-07-00
Cover Price: 1.75 USD; 2.25 CAD; 1.30 GBP Rating:Â Approved by the Comics Code Authority
Synopsis:Â As Destro, alongside the Baroness, makes the Silent Castle go topsy-turvy with Cobra in pursuit, Hawk sends in Snake-Eyes and Storm Shadow to exfiltrate them. The Joes are successful, but Snake-Eyes makes the hardest decision as he stabs Scarlett near her heart to grievously injure her, making her double agent status more legitimate. Megatron, in damaged mode from issue #79 of Transformers (Marvel, 1984 series), then makes a surprise visit to the castle, but things aren't all that bad (?) as the Commander has a talk with him.
Characters:Â G.I. Joe [Hawk; Wild Bill; Snake-Eyes; Storm Shadow; Stalker]; Cobra [Cobra Commander; Dreadnoks [Zarana; Road Pig]; Tele-Vipers; Techno-Vipers; Ninja Force [Slice; Dice; Red Ninjas]; Scarlett (double agent); Dr. Biggles-Jones (double agent)]; Baroness; Destro
Cover Pencils: Andrew Wildman Cover Inks: Andrew Wildman Story Script: Larry Hama Story Inks: Stephen Baskerville Story Colors: Bob Sharen
